Home energy storage battery capacity indicates the total electric energy that can be stored in a battery, which is measured in kilowatt-hours (kWh). Different battery capacities are available for different purposes. Some may only power essential appliances during short outages while others can cover an entire home’s power consumption for long periods. Batteries with higher capacity will store more energy, but may also be larger, more expensive, and take up more space. Homeowners should consider their average daily energy usage, backup needs, and budget to optimize energy capture and utilization.
